CSS Centre

The CSS Centre is a platform to manage your participation in the CSS programme. Core CSS Centre features allow you to do the following:

  • Administration:
    • Manage your participation in CSS programme opportunities
    • Manage the logo that is shown on Google
    • Prove your CSS eligibility
    • Apply CSS-specific user management, including setting access rights to associated Merchant Center accounts
  • Manage your merchants' portfolio:
    • Grow your portfolio with the self-service merchants' onboarding feature (switching MC accounts)
    • Get your portfolio organised via labels and filters
    • Gain a holistic overview of participating CSS domains, as well as all associated Merchant Center (MC) accounts
    • Provide a single point of entry for all associated MC accounts
    • Manage your merchants' issues and growth at scale via aggregated diagnostics, tips and best practices
  • Manage your CSS product pages:
    • Understand issues that do not allow your CSS product pages to be shown across Google
    • See all CSS product pages and their performance

What are Comparison Listing ads?

Comparison Listing ads (CLA) have been launched in all 21 (EEA+CH) countries, but we need a minimum of three CSS competing in an auction to be able to show ads. When choosing a country, note that not all countries may have the minimum of three CSS competing at the moment. You can ask your CSS Google account manager for more details.
To learn more about CLA, refer to this deck and this Help Centre article.
If you're interested in running CLA, contact your CSS Google account manager to be allowlisted.

How can I opt in or opt out of Display remarketing or Shopping ads beyond general search?

By default, a CSS is only able to place products in the Shopping unit on Google's general search results pages.
To opt in for:
  • Display remarketing
  • Shopping ads beyond general search (including the Shopping tab, image search and YouTube)
Use this form (Parallel tracking exemption and opt-ins section).
